Huntington Beach vs Riverside: Dialysis Technician Salary (2026)
Compare dialysis technician salaries between Huntington Beach, CA and Riverside, CA. All figures are 2026 estimates projected from BLS 2025 data.
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Metric | Huntington Beach, CA | Riverside, CA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Salary | $53,040▲ | $51,395 |
| Hourly Rate | $25.50▲ | $24.71 |
| Entry Level (P10) | $41,159 | $41,257▲ |
| 25th Percentile | $47,047▲ | $44,339 |
| 75th Percentile | $67,215▲ | $56,749 |
| Top Earner (P90) | $82,213▲ | $70,636 |
| Total Employed | 50 | 2,450▲ |
Verdict
Huntington Beach, CA offers better overall compensation for dialysis technicians, winning 3 out of 4 metrics compared to Riverside.
The salary gap between Huntington Beach and Riverside is $1,645 (3.20%). Huntington Beach's median is +17.03% compared to the US national median of $45,322.
Salary Range Comparison
The full salary range (10th to 90th percentile) in Huntington Beach spans $41,054,Riverside spans $29,379. Huntington Beach has a wider pay range, meaning more potential for high earners but also more variation.
Cost-of-Living Adjusted Comparison
After cost-of-living adjustment, Riverside ($48,285 effective) pays 2.96% more than Huntington Beach ($46,897 effective).
Cost-of-living adjustment: salary × (100 / CoL index). Index of 100 = national average.

Methodology & Data Source
All salary figures are 2026 projections based on BLS OEWS May 2025 data. A 2.41% CAGR (derived from 6-year national BLS trends) was applied to estimate current compensation. Cost-of-living adjustments use BEA Regional Price Parity data. Actual salaries vary by employer, certifications, and experience.
